some network play details

In network play, multiple players can enjoy adventures in the same world. The theme tying all this in is "mutually helping each other". During network play, if you due, you go into a condition called "Soul Body". In this condition, if you release a "soul sign", a player who is still alive can summon you, allowing you to still participate in the game. The system is designed so the living and those deceased and existing as soul bodies can cooperate and progress through adventures together.

One player can "summon" up to 2 "soul bodies"

Players can leave messages on the map for other players as well (could be used to indicate where treasure chests might lie, where enemies might be hidden, etc)..

Oh and as far as death is concerned. If you die in your physical body you are turned into a soul and your HP is halved. It seems the only way to get your physical body back is to defeat one of the big demons? I don't know because I kept getting my ass kicked by this armor guy with a spear and a red eye who can kill me in one hit. Almost killed him once. lol

I also don't have the item which you can use to let someone summon you.

Seeing other character's spirits and their messages all over the place is pretty cool. It's funny too because some people put down fake messages and then you will see another one that says 'Beware messages that lie!"

Oh and about character classes, it appears that the choice you make at the beginning just affects your starting stats and equipment. It seems to be completely up to you after that.
